Abstract
Artificial Intelligence (AI) technology has revolutionized various industries, and the retail sector is no exception. This thesis aims to analyze the impact of AI on supply chain management within the retail industry. The study explores how AI technologies such as machine learning, predictive analytics, and robotics have transformed traditional supply chain practices and enhanced operational efficiency in retail businesses. The research investigates the benefits, challenges, and implications of integrating AI into supply chain management processes and highlights the key factors that influence successful AI adoption in retail supply chains. The research methodology involves a comprehensive literature review to examine existing studies, theories, and frameworks related to AI in supply chain management and retail operations. The study also includes empirical research, incorporating surveys and interviews with industry experts, supply chain managers, and AI technology providers to gather insights and opinions on the subject matter. Findings from the research reveal that AI technologies have significantly improved supply chain performance in the retail industry by enabling real-time data analysis, demand forecasting, inventory optimization, and logistics automation. However, challenges such as data security, integration complexities, and workforce upskilling pose barriers to widespread AI adoption in supply chain management. The study emphasizes the importance of strategic planning, organizational readiness, and continuous innovation to harness the full potential of AI in retail supply chains. In conclusion, this thesis contributes to the growing body of knowledge on the role of AI in transforming supply chain management practices in the retail sector. The findings provide valuable insights for retail businesses, policymakers, and researchers seeking to leverage AI technologies for competitive advantage and operational excellence in supply chain operations. By understanding the impact of AI on supply chain management, retail companies can adapt to the evolving technological landscape and drive sustainable growth in a rapidly changing business environment.
Thesis Overview
The research project titled "Analyzing the Impact of Artificial Intelligence on Supply Chain Management in the Retail Industry" aims to investigate how the integration of artificial intelligence (AI) technologies impacts supply chain management practices within the retail sector. Supply chain management is a critical component of the retail industry, involving the coordination of activities such as sourcing, production, inventory management, logistics, and distribution to ensure the efficient flow of goods from suppliers to customers. In recent years, the rapid advancements in AI technologies have presented new opportunities and challenges for retail supply chain management.
This study will delve into the current landscape of AI applications in supply chain management within the retail industry, exploring the various AI tools and techniques that are being utilized to optimize and streamline supply chain processes. The research will analyze how AI is being used to enhance demand forecasting, inventory management, warehouse operations, transportation logistics, and customer service in retail supply chains. By examining real-world case studies and industry best practices, the project aims to provide insights into the benefits and limitations of AI adoption in retail supply chain management.
Moreover, the research will assess the impact of AI on key performance indicators (KPIs) such as cost reduction, inventory turnover, order fulfillment accuracy, lead times, and customer satisfaction in retail supply chains. By conducting interviews with industry experts, surveys with retail supply chain professionals, and data analysis of AI implementation outcomes, the study seeks to identify the critical success factors and challenges associated with integrating AI technologies into retail supply chain operations.
Furthermore, the research will explore the implications of AI adoption on the workforce in retail supply chain management, considering the potential changes in job roles, skills requirements, and organizational structures brought about by AI technology. The project will also address ethical considerations related to AI implementation, including data privacy, security, bias, and transparency in decision-making processes within retail supply chains.
Overall, this research overview highlights the importance of understanding the impact of AI on supply chain management in the retail industry and underscores the need for strategic planning, organizational readiness, and continuous innovation to harness the full potential of AI technologies for enhancing operational efficiency, agility, and competitiveness in retail supply chains.
